About Carol Tice

With 25+ years in the industry, Carol’s expertise spans staff reporting and high-stakes freelancing. She crafted 1,200+ articles during her seven-year tenure at Puget Sound Business Journal, covering everything from startups to corporate finance. This real-world experience fuels her practical advice for creators.

Her client roster reads like a Fortune 500 highlight reel: Forbes, Costco, and American Express trust her to articulate their stories. This isn’t just name-dropping—it’s proof she understands what premium clients value in collaborators.

In 2011, Carol launched the Make a Living Writing blog, which became a global hub for career-focused creators. At its peak, the site drew nearly one million annual visitors seeking actionable strategies. “Great writing isn’t enough,” she often notes. “You need business savvy to thrive long-term.”

Her crowning achievement? Building Freelance Writers Den into a 1,500-member powerhouse before exiting in 2021. Members gained not just courses, but a roadmap she’d tested through her own transitions—from journalist to six-figure ghostwriter.

Time Management and Job Board Strategies

Balancing deadlines with client outreach? Tools like Trello or Asana simplify task tracking. Color-coded boards let you prioritize high-value projects. Pair these with job board alerts from platforms like ProBlogger to spot opportunities faster.

Set daily time blocks for pitching and content creation. Apps like RescueTime reveal productivity patterns, helping you eliminate distractions. One writer cut administrative hours by 40% using automated scheduling tools.

Utilizing Media and Social Management Tools

Social media management platforms like Buffer or Hootsuite centralize posting across networks. Schedule a week’s content in minutes using drag-and-drop calendars. Analytics dashboards highlight top-performing posts to refine your strategy.

For visual content, Canva’s templates create polished graphics without design skills. Combine these media management tools with Grammarly’s tone checker to maintain brand voice consistency. This toolkit lets you focus on crafting quality work—not repetitive tasks.
